I'm happy with the results. The modifications we performed lowered the trailer about 12". Built a ramp that when in the up position fits under the tarp and works well driving in 4 wheeler and motorcycle.

Ithaca did a nice job on his trailer. A drop axle seems a lot simpler than notching the frame or doing a spring under (as long as ground clearance is not a major concern.

Ithaca, what is you deck height now?
